Transaction 91cfc482f72e98048dfe3666673f000e1170c8c3f2735bde5933e843f128ca29

1 Input
1 Outputs
  • 91cfc482f72e98048dfe3666673f000e1170c8c3f2735bde5933e843f128ca29:0
  • value  65231706
    address  15A4Rpv8pqNTLyvBQMefCGQ8oxNbpUpKsp